When to send it
- Day 0Document every incident with dates, witnesses, and quotes.
- Within 180-300 daysFile the charge with the EEOC (deadline varies by state agency).
- During investigationRespond to EEOC requests and provide your supporting letter and evidence.
- After right-to-sueFile a Title VII lawsuit within 90 days of receiving the letter.

How long do I have to file with the EEOC?
Generally 180 days from the discriminatory act, extended to 300 days in states with their own fair employment agency.
What does Title VII protect against?
Title VII of the Civil Rights Act of 1964 bars discrimination based on race, color, religion, sex, or national origin, including retaliation for complaining.
